API Reference (v2)PartsRevisions
Update part revision
Update a part revision's number or image. Identifies the revision by part number and revision number in the URL.
PATCH
/v2/parts/{part_number}/revisions/{revision_number}AuthorizationBearer <token>
API key for authentication. Use format: Bearer YOUR_API_KEY
In: header
Path Parameters
part_numberstring
Part number that the revision belongs to.
revision_numberstring
Current revision number to update.
number?string
New revision number to set.
Match
^[a-zA-Z0-9_.:+-]+$Length
1 <= length <= 60image_id?string
Upload ID for the revision image, or empty string to remove image
Response Body
from tofupilot.v2 import TofuPilot
# Initialize the TofuPilot client
client = TofuPilot()
# Execute the operation
result = client.parts.revisions.update(
part_number="string",
revision_number="string"
)
# Handle response
print(result){
"id": "550e8400-e29b-41d4-a716-446655440000"
}{
"message": "Unauthorized",
"code": "UNAUTHORIZED",
"issues": []
}{
"message": "Not found",
"code": "NOT_FOUND",
"issues": []
}{
"message": "Conflict",
"code": "CONFLICT",
"issues": []
}{
"message": "Internal server error",
"code": "INTERNAL_SERVER_ERROR",
"issues": []
}How is this guide?
Get part revision GET
Retrieve a single part revision by its part number and revision number, including revision metadata, configuration details, and linked units.
Delete part revision DELETE
Permanently delete a part revision by its part number and revision number. This action removes the revision and all associated data and cannot be undone.